Palos Height, Ill. – For the first time during the 2016 campaign, the Corban University women's soccer team failed to score a goal in a match, ultimately resulting in a 2-0 defeat against Trinity Christian College (Ill.) on Monday afternoon.
"We tried to battle the heat and came up short," said Corban head coach Likius Hafeni. "We are very satisfied with what we accomplished over the last few days. We are looking forward to the upcoming games!"
The Trolls scored in the 27th minute to take the initial lead, and then sealed the deal in the 83rd minute with a second goal, resulting in the two-goal triumph.
For the match, Trinity Christian (3-1) outshot Corban, 9-8, and held the corner-kick edge, 4-2.
The Warriors seemed to be threatening for almost the entirety of the second half, but good last-second defensive plays or goalkeeper saves kept the Warriors out of the back of the net, resulting in the defeat. Senior forward Randi Donahue (Bellingham, Wash.) led Corban with two shots.
